Consolidate Audio Clips

Streamline your Pro Tools workflow by mastering the art of consolidating audio clips. This audio editing technique is essential for clip management, especially in complex sessions.

Begin by highlighting all audio tracks intended for merging. Access the "Edit" menu, then select "Consolidate Clip" to seamlessly fuse these clips, ensuring any deliberate splits or gaps remain intact.

The consolidation process automatically integrates track names onto the newly formed stems, facilitating effortless project organization. This clip management strategy is vital for efficient workflow optimization, as it converts fragmented clips into a single contiguous audio file, simplifying subsequent mixing or mastering stages.

Select Bounce Options

To efficiently select bounce options in Pro Tools, initiate by highlighting the required tracks and employing the shortcut Ctrl + Shift + K to access the export settings.

Within the bounce settings, it is imperative to select the WAV format and set the audio format to 32-bit float with a sample rate of 44.1 kHz for best audio fidelity.

Additionally, guarantee meticulous organization of the export directory and accurate labeling of stems to streamline retrieval and minimize errors in subsequent mixing and mastering stages.

Choose Audio Format

Selecting the appropriate audio format during the bounce process in Pro Tools is critical for guaranteeing the integrity and quality of your stems.

Begin by highlighting all desired tracks, then use the shortcut Ctrl + Shift + K to open the bounce dialog box. For ideal audio quality considerations, choose WAV format, known for its lossless nature and suitability for professional mixing and mastering.

Set the format to 32-bit float to leverage higher dynamic range, critical for post-production flexibility. Address format compatibility issues by maintaining a standard sample rate of 44.1 kHz, balancing quality with manageable file sizes.

Review your export settings overview to guarantee efficient directory organization, facilitating easy retrieval of stems post-bounce and streamlining project management.

Set Audio Parameters

Having established the importance of selecting the WAV format, it is imperative to configure the audio parameters in Pro Tools to guarantee superior output quality.

Begin by setting your session's sample rate to 44.1 kHz and a bit depth of 32-bit float for ideal audio quality and efficient file management. Navigate to the "Setup" menu and access "Playback Engine" to fine-tune the buffer size, ensuring performance enhancement.

Verify and adjust sample rate settings through the "Session Setup" window to prevent routing issues during export. Additionally, confirm that all tracks are routed correctly to the desired output path.

  • Access "I/O Setup" to validate input and output configurations.
  • Ensure the mix is directed to the correct bus or output.
  • Adjust buffer size for ideal performance.

Organize Exported Files

Once the stems have been accurately verified and labeled, attention must shift to the organizational structure of the exported files. Implementing robust file management strategies is essential for maintaining workflow efficiency. Begin by creating a designated folder for exported stems to guarantee easy accessibility. Employ effective naming conventions that incorporate track names and stem versioning techniques to avoid confusion. Utilize subfolders to categorize stems by type, such as vocals, instruments, or effects, enhancing file organization.

  • Maintain a backup of original project files alongside exports for future reference.
  • Include a readme file within the export folder detailing contents and any specific notes.
  • Assure consistent and clear labeling of each stem to streamline communication with mixing/mastering engineers.

For enhanced data security, consider employing the three-location backup rule which involves keeping the original file and two additional copies, one of which is off-site, to safeguard against unforeseen data loss.
